# Murkwell Rebuild Service — Environments

The Murkwell incremental rebuild service runs in three environments: sandbox, staging, and production. Each maintains its own dependency graph cache, so a page edit triggers rebuilds only of affected routes within that environment. Contractors should note that sandbox rebuilds are throttled aggressively and staging mirrors production's cache-invalidation rules exactly. Never copy caches between environments. Production currently operates with the configuration values listed below.

config for kawif-hahig:
zorix:
  log_level: error
  metrics_host: metrics.zorix.lumiclabs.internal
  pool_size: 16

Ticket: CSV import wizard config drift (Quillbarrow staging)

Flagging this for the weekly sync — the import wizard on staging has drifted again from what's in the repo. Delimiter sniffing is on in staging but off in prod, and the row-batch size doesn't match either environment. Probably someone hot-patched it during the Dunmore onboarding push and never backported. Anyway, here's what staging is actually running right now.

service settings:
PRAIX_LOG_LEVEL=error
PRAIX_METRICS_HOST=metrics.praix.qorvelcorp.corp
PRAIX_POOL_SIZE=16

Ticket: Missed pick-up — raffle drums, Solstice staff party

The two brass raffle drums staged at dock 1 were not collected yesterday; Arden Express logged the stop as "premises closed," which is incorrect. Pick-up has been rebooked for tomorrow morning. Please keep both drums crated and by the roller door, and personally meet the driver. The confidential hand-over instruction appears immediately below.

handover note for yagef-bagep: the drudor pelius courier leaves the kasdor zorvan norir ledger at gate 8016 under passcode 755406

## Onboarding: PedalShift Rebalancer

PedalShift moves bikes between dock stations based on demand forecasts from the Harrowby depot model. Support staff can trigger manual rebalancing runs, but each dispatch payload must be signed or the field app rejects it. Please store credentials only in the vault. The current dispatch signing key appears below.

release key, fahaf-bajof: bky3_Xam